Business Model and Revenue Streams
Theatrical, Home Video, and Licensing
The core of a24 net worth is built on a multifaceted business model. Box office returns provide initial visibility and cash flow, while home video and premium cable deals deepen long term earnings.
Licensing and international distribution amplify each title, allowing the studio to monetize content across territories and formats efficiently.

Content Portfolio and Hit Drivers
Flagship Films and Series Impact
A24 net worth is heavily influenced by a small set of breakout projects that generate outsized returns. Films and series with strong critical reception tend to perform well on streaming and home video, extending revenue windows.
Strategic marketing and curated releases help convert niche audiences into broad commercial success, reinforcing the studio’s financial resilience.

How is a24 net worth estimated if financials are not public?
Analyst estimates combine industry benchmarks, reported deals, production budgets, and revenue splits from known titles, adjusted for market conditions and risk.
Which revenue source contributes most to a24 net worth?
While theatrical launches generate prestige, long term licensing and streaming residuals typically provide the largest share of cumulative value over time.
